diff --git a/config/advanced-install/namespaced-numaflow-server.yaml b/config/advanced-install/namespaced-numaflow-server.yaml index 189524b08d..cc56671591 100644 --- a/config/advanced-install/namespaced-numaflow-server.yaml +++ b/config/advanced-install/namespaced-numaflow-server.yaml @@ -291,6 +291,11 @@ spec: name: env-volume - args: - server-secrets-init + env: + - name: NAMESPACE + valueFrom: + fieldRef: + fieldPath: metadata.namespace image: quay.io/numaproj/numaflow:latest imagePullPolicy: Always name: server-secrets-init diff --git a/config/advanced-install/numaflow-server.yaml b/config/advanced-install/numaflow-server.yaml index 7f1224cbd6..0ad97ef67e 100644 --- a/config/advanced-install/numaflow-server.yaml +++ b/config/advanced-install/numaflow-server.yaml @@ -302,6 +302,11 @@ spec: name: env-volume - args: - server-secrets-init + env: + - name: NAMESPACE + valueFrom: + fieldRef: + fieldPath: metadata.namespace image: quay.io/numaproj/numaflow:latest imagePullPolicy: Always name: server-secrets-init diff --git a/config/base/numaflow-server/numaflow-server-deployment.yaml b/config/base/numaflow-server/numaflow-server-deployment.yaml index bd821dd76d..44b0d7c322 100644 --- a/config/base/numaflow-server/numaflow-server-deployment.yaml +++ b/config/base/numaflow-server/numaflow-server-deployment.yaml @@ -47,6 +47,11 @@ spec: args: - "server-secrets-init" imagePullPolicy: Always + env: + - name: NAMESPACE + valueFrom: + fieldRef: + fieldPath: metadata.namespace containers: - name: main image: quay.io/numaproj/numaflow:latest diff --git a/config/install.yaml b/config/install.yaml index f7c08b33f9..212ee1438b 100644 --- a/config/install.yaml +++ b/config/install.yaml @@ -16796,6 +16796,11 @@ spec: name: env-volume - args: - server-secrets-init + env: + - name: NAMESPACE + valueFrom: + fieldRef: + fieldPath: metadata.namespace image: quay.io/numaproj/numaflow:latest imagePullPolicy: Always name: server-secrets-init diff --git a/config/namespace-install.yaml b/config/namespace-install.yaml index abbcd68df5..1d83588ce9 100644 --- a/config/namespace-install.yaml +++ b/config/namespace-install.yaml @@ -16688,6 +16688,11 @@ spec: name: env-volume - args: - server-secrets-init + env: + - name: NAMESPACE + valueFrom: + fieldRef: + fieldPath: metadata.namespace image: quay.io/numaproj/numaflow:latest imagePullPolicy: Always name: server-secrets-init